Super car Saturday, A total of 8 Vipers turned out :2tu: Here's a YouTube Video of the day (and me making a nice cup of tea on my rear wing) :D

[media]http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=XGD-gdEAi-g[/media]

We left Hyde Park corner at 6am, thundered through west London, then headed down to Thruxton motor racing circuit, the very nice chap in the Bugatti Veyron owns Wilton House, where we then put the cars on static display later in the afternoon for the public to admire ;)
We also had a noise sound off, sadly I only managed 117 decibels, the winner was the F40 :)
